Output ec31cd831c8a122f68f6076b9275a2f47685f4b65dc8884d7a9c8d17133e2025:3

value
198953282
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2270212b0b2bfa2bc9b46cac693b24c58e6f8c815398211d680802ec6d004319
address
tb1pyfczz2ct90azhjd5djkxjweyck8xlryp2wvzz8tgpqpwcmgqgvvsts4jyf
transaction
ec31cd831c8a122f68f6076b9275a2f47685f4b65dc8884d7a9c8d17133e2025
confirmations
52391
spent
true